#be7d38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be7d38 is composed of 74.5% red, 49%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.2% magenta, 70.5%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 30.9 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 48.2%. #be7d38 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ffa70 with #7d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#be7d38 color description : Moderate orange.
#be7d38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#be7d38 has RGB values of R:190, G:125,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.71,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12483896.

Shades and Tints of #be7d38
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080502 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#be7d38
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7b7a is the less saturated color, while #ed7e09 is the most saturated one.
